Scope in detail

  1. Enterprise Identity Providers (Entra ID, Okta, Ping)

    Cloud identity architecture on Microsoft Entra ID, Okta or Ping Identity — SSO across SaaS and internal applications, SCIM provisioning, group-based licensing and application-catalogue governance.

  2. SSO, Federation & Application Onboarding

    SAML, OIDC and WS-Federation integration for SaaS and legacy web applications, coordinated onboarding pipelines and centralised entitlement management so one identity works across every application.

  3. MFA & Passwordless Authentication

    FIDO2 security keys, Windows Hello for Business, platform authenticators and phishing-resistant push — reducing password dependence for the majority of the workforce while preserving governed break-glass paths.

  4. Conditional Access & Zero Trust

    Risk-based sign-in policies, device compliance signals from unified endpoint management, session controls and continuous access evaluation — aligned to NIST SP 800-207 Zero Trust principles where relevant.

  5. Identity Governance & Joiner-Mover-Leaver

    HRIS-driven identity flows (Workday, SAP SuccessFactors, Oracle HCM, BambooHR) that automate provisioning, access reviews and deprovisioning — with attestation and audit-ready reporting.

  6. Privileged Identity & Access Management (PIM / PAM)

    Just-in-time elevation, approval workflows, credential vaulting and session recording with BeyondTrust, CyberArk, Delinea and Entra Privileged Identity Management — standing privilege becomes the exception, not the default.

  7. External Identity, B2B & CIAM

    Guest access, partner federation, cross-tenant trust and customer identity management (CIAM) — enabling secure collaboration and customer-facing sign-in without shadow accounts or unmanaged credentials.

  8. RBAC, Entitlement Management & Access Reviews

    Role-Based Access Control models, entitlement packages, access reviews and separation-of-duties enforcement — mapped to job families, regulatory obligations and application ownership.

Where workplace programmes break down

  • Leaver access lingers after departure

    Leaver revocation depends on manual tickets, so orphan accounts, SaaS entitlements and shared credentials remain active well after departure.

  • MFA coverage is inconsistent

    MFA is enforced on some applications but bypassed on others, and legacy authentication paths remain open, leaving well-known attack surfaces exposed.

  • Conditional access ignores device posture

    Sign-in policies check user risk in isolation, without device compliance signals from UEM, so access decisions no longer reflect endpoint state.

  • Application onboarding is ad-hoc

    New SaaS applications are federated one at a time by different teams, so entitlement models, SCIM provisioning and audit reporting differ between platforms.
